问题标签 [redash]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
185 浏览

sql - 我正在处理仪表板,我在其中询问前 30 天的日期和查询结果

我正在处理仪表板,我在其中询问前 30 天的日期和查询结果。我正在尝试使用 dateadd 函数,但它抛出了错误month cannot be resolved

这里结束日期部分是参数化的。我不是这方面的专家,所以如果有人能解决这个问题,那就太好了。使用 athena db 在 redash 中执行此操作。

0 投票
1 回答
116 浏览

mongodb - 在 Redash 中更新 Mongo 文档的查询

我正在尝试查找查询以使用 Redash 更新 Mongo 文档中的记录。我想出了以下查询,但它不起作用。有人可以帮忙吗?我对 Redash 的了解是它使用 Pymongo。

0 投票
0 回答
102 浏览

metadata - 将 Redash 元数据与 Snowflake 集成

我已将 Redash 与 Snowflake 集成为数据源之一。

我们在 Redash 元数据表中获得了参数的值,例如和query_id,它为我们提供了与历史上在 Redash 上执行的查询相关的所有元数据。queryuser_nameevents

Snowflake 还将查询元数据存储在一个名为的表中,该表QUERY_HISTORY具有与历史上在雪花上执行的查询相关的信息。它有user_namerole_name字段,但它们都存储与雪花关联的 Redash 用户的名称。

缺少有关哪个登录用户执行查询的信息。此外,在任何元数据信息中都没有办法(可能是一些通用标识符 - 查询 ID)将 Redash 元数据中的查询与雪花上执行的查询映射。

让我知道我是否遗漏了什么,或者我们是否可以通过某种方式实现相同的目标。

重划线版本:7.0.0

0 投票
1 回答
3904 浏览

amazon-s3 - 调用 StartQueryExecution 操作时出现错误“请求中包含的安全令牌无效”UnrecognizedClientException

在使用 athena 凭据重新设置数据源连接时出现错误。

我在雅典娜有一个有效的访问权限,我可以在其中运行查询并从 S3 获取日志。现在我想将 athena 与 redash 集成,所以我收到错误“调用 StartQueryExecution 操作时发生错误(UnrecognizedClientException):请求中包含的安全令牌无效。”

如果我在这里遗漏了什么,请告诉我。我对我的用户拥有雅典娜的完全访问权限。

请找到所附图片并帮助我解决这个问题。 在此处输入图像描述

在此处输入图像描述

0 投票
1 回答
33 浏览

sql - 表上出现 id 和另一个表中所有元素的最佳方法

好吧,我需要的查询很简单,也许在另一个问题中,但是我需要的是性能方面的东西,所以:

我有一个包含 10.000 行的用户表,该表包含 id、电子邮件和更多数据。

在另一个名为orders的表中,我有更多的行,可能有 150.000 行。

在这个订单中,我有下订单的用户的ID ,以及订单的状态状态可以是从 0 到 9(或 null)的数字。

我的最终要求是让每个用户的id、电子邮件、其他列以及状态为 3 或 7 的订单数量。它不关心它的 3 或 7,我只需要数量

但我需要以低影响的方式(或高效的方式)进行此查询。

最好的方法是什么?

我需要用 postgres 10 重新运行它。

0 投票
1 回答
459 浏览

sql - 在 redash 仪表板上,是什么原因导致“运行查询时出错:100035 (22007):无法识别时间戳 'd_yesterday'”?

在由 Snowflake 数据库支持的 Redash 应用程序实例上,我设置了一个仪表板,其中包含许多查询,每个查询都采用date名为startDate.

我的每个查询都被编码为通过 WHERE 子句应用仪表板的选定日期,例如:

在大多数情况下,这工作正常。

但是,当在我的仪表板上,对于startDate参数,我选择特殊值Yesterday(而不是特定日期),我的一些(但不是全部)查询显示错误而不是显示任何数据:Error running query: 100035 (22007): Timestamp 'd_yesterday' is not recognized.

这个错误是什么意思,我该如何解决?

0 投票
1 回答
1037 浏览

react-native - 用 redash 和 reanimated 反应原生捏缩放

我只是想通过使用 reanimated 和 redash 来缩放图像。

我跟着这个教程

但是我抓取的组件位于前一个组件之上,但位于下一个组件之下。我知道这有点复杂的解释。为此,我试图绘制一个模式来更好地解释你。

在此处输入图像描述

因此,在上面的图像中,1,2 和 3 是我保存图像的卡片。我捏缩放到第二张图像,但它保持在第一个图像之上(这是我想要的),但在这种情况下,它也保持在下一张第三张卡片的下方。

我怎样才能防止这种情况?

这是组件

0 投票
0 回答
53 浏览

mongodb - MongoDB聚合转换

我有一个 MongoDB,它在Redash中用于查询一些数据。对于我想通过 Redash 显示的漏斗,我有一个 MongoDB 查询,结果是这样的

但实际上 Redash 中的漏斗图请求了一个看起来像

如何扩展我的 MongoDB 聚合以获得想要的结果?也许只是手动创建所需的行?怎么做?

0 投票
1 回答
111 浏览

jquery - 在 MongoDB 中使用 Match exp 和 objectId

我正在创建一个带有变量的查询以添加一个键并对应于我需要检查提到的 id 是否等于所有者 id 的键。我将此代码与名称一起使用,它工作正常,但对于对象 ID,我遇到了错误。我尝试了 toObjectId 函数,但它在 MongoDB 中无法识别。在这种情况下如何使用匹配功能?我应该在哪里添加“$oid”功能或其他可以提供帮助的东西?

0 投票
1 回答
278 浏览

sql - 如何在 redash 中插入基于计数结果的查询过滤器

我相信这是一个简单的问题,但由于我不熟悉 redash,所以它似乎很难。

我有一个redash中的查询,

给出这样的结果: 在此处输入图像描述

截至目前,我可以在store location. 但现在我想query filter根据列添加photo。我该怎么做?store location基本上我想通过列中的和计数来过滤redash仪表板中的结果photo